Chapter 390: The Returning Dragon


Translator: Sparrow Translations Editor: Sparrow Translations


...


Fang Zhengzhi had no idea if he was awake or not. All he remembered was that he had a very strange dream after being hit by Yan Xiu.


In this dream, he was in his pocket dimension.


However...


His pocket dimension was clearly different. This time, the fruits on the huge tree were adorned with patterns. The sea of white mist was also glistening.


Of course, the most attention-grabbing fruit on the tree was the purple one.


A queer, crystal-like glow could be seen from the fruit. It became brighter and brighter, so much so that his entire pocket dimension was stained purple.


The trees were now purple in color, the leaves and branches bathing in purple light. Even the vast ocean glistened purple.


As the purple became more and more intense...


Fang Zhengzhi felt a deep-seated rage grow. He felt like he was losing control of himself and his actions became more involuntary.


In the end...


When he opened his eyes again, he saw an ancient city.


This was a city made up of red rocks. From afar, it looked like a giant beast bathing in blood.


There were two words emblazoned in red atop the city walls.


Blood Shadow.


Fang Zhengzhi knew what the Blood Shadow City was. However, he had no idea why he would dream of such a place. After all, he had never been there before.


How could he dream of it if he had never been there?


Okay then...


That was not the most important point. The most important point was that he saw a sword.


This sword shot straight into the heavens and morphed into a humongous dragon. It roared, causing the ground to shake, as it enjoyed its freedom.


Then, it turned back and tunneled back into the ground in a show of force.


This was known as...


The Returning Dragon!


...


The purple dragon continued to circle in the sky before it finally morphed back into a ray of purple light which shot back down towards the middle-aged demon next to Wu Ji.


"Die!"


The purple dragon's roar sent chills down everyone's spine.


The middle-aged man stared at that purple light. He knew that this had come from Fang Zhengzhi, and he knew that Fang Zhengzhi was merely in the pinnacle Heavenly Reflection State.


For someone like that to attack...


He should not have felt threatened.


However, when he saw the purple light tunneling towards him, he felt an intense wave of fear. He did not know if it was because the light had enough power to destroy everything in its path...


Or because...


Of the aura it was exuding.


It had a lonely aura, almost as if it was alone at the very top. It felt as though this single attack could destroy an entire star.


The middle-aged man tightened his grip on his sword instinctively.


He did not know exactly how strong this attack was. However, he had a feeling that it was very powerful. It was so powerful that he wanted to escape.


However, could he dodge?


No!


He was the stronger individual.


This was the pride and arrogance that he had. After all, Yun Qingwu was behind him watching this fight.


His blade was already marked after his clash with Yan Xiu. However, he was not bothered by it.


The reason was simple.


He was in the Rebirth State. He was the more powerful one.


He raised his sword and the blade glowed purple. He charged forward like a bolt of lightning, straight towards the ray of purple coming towards him...


"Boom!"


An explosion rocked the entire area as the two rays of purple continued to clash and tear at each other. The roars of the purple dragon continued to resonate.


Then, silence. Complete, utter silence.


Only one sound could be heard, the cold crisp roar of the dragon. Other than that, there was no second sound to be heard.


Everyone was captivated by the battle.


The 50,000 strong Great Xia Dynasty army stopped fighting as they looked at the two rays of purple duking it out. All of the Southern Region soldiers also stopped fighting as they watched in awe.


The candidates were all holding their breath...


The demon elites were holding their breaths as well. They were all immensely powerful and could feel the energies contained within the two rays of purple.


The Dragon Protection Squad continued to hold onto their blades. They had been through rigorous and strict training, but even they could not resist looking at the two rays of purple.


Nangong Hao, Bai Xing, Wu Ji, Yun Qingwu, Xing Qingsui... there was no one on the battlefield who wasn't looking at the two rays of purple.


All of them only had one thought in their mind...


How does a pinnacle Heavenly Reflection State cultivator fight a Rebirth State cultivator? Furthermore, the duel seemed quite evenly matched.


"Kaboom..."


The roars faded but it was quickly replaced by thunder and a downpour. The raindrops were as large as beans and they brought with them a winter-like cold.


The rain pummeled the ground and sent mud flying all over the place. It began to wash away the blood on the ground, forming little streams all over the battlefield.


The battle ceased temporarily.


Both the Great Xia Dynasty army and the Southern Region army stood their ground, allowing the rain to slide off their armor.


It was cold...


But they didn't seem to be bothered.


All of the candidates were also under the brutal a.s.sault of the rain. Normally, they would find a nice restaurant to hide out, or a nice bar to have a drink. At the very least, they would use their abilities to shut out the rain.


But now...


Nothing like that happened.


All of the candidates stood rooted to the ground, the raindrops pummeling their faces and flowing down their necks.


"How did this happen?"


"How is that possible?"


"Am I dreaming?"


Whispers could be heard as candidates looked to one another. The roar of the dragon had all disappeared, and it was replaced with the calmness of the rain.


Then, the troops began to move.


All of the soldiers of the Great Xia Dynasty raised their spears, their expressions filled with excitement.


The expressions of the 100,000 Southern Region army froze. They still could not rid themselves of the shock and awe from what they just witnessed.


Xing Qingsui's expression was complicated. However, there were traces of surprise, almost as if he saw the light at the end of the tunnel.


Nangong Hao gripped his blade tightly. However, this imposing stance was not because of his opponent.


It had come from his heart.


"Fang Zhengzhi!" Bai Xing rarely called out someone else's name when in battle. However, this time, he yelled it out.


His tone was icy beyond belief.


...


Fang Zhengzhi thought that he was in a dream. He thought that the pocket dimension he saw was just a dream, and the purple stain was a dream as well.


Furthermore, his visit to the Blood Shadow City confirmed in his mind that he was in a dream.


Because he was in a dream, he did not feel much emotions except for the growing killing intent.


But now...


He felt as though the dream was becoming a reality.


He seemed to have returned to the battlefield. He saw Yan Xiu in front of him, his body glowing red.


Other than Yan Xiu, he saw two middle-aged men staring at him. One of them was holding a blade stained with blood.


Of course, everything that he saw was through a purple lens. Even though he could tell that it was fresh red blood, he saw it as purple.


The faces of the two middle-aged men were also purple.


Fang Zhengzhi wanted to ask what was going on. Were they fighting?


However, when he saw Yan Xiu spit out a mouthful of blood whilst enveloped by a red glow, he did not ask any questions. He was consumed by a rage and a thirst to kill.


Yan Xiu was injured?


Fang Zhengzhi thought that he was in a dream. However, he never expected Yan Xiu to be beaten to this state even in a dream.


He placed his hand on yan Xiu's shoulders.


He did not speak. He knew that he was transferring some of his killing intent into Yan Xiu's heart and he knew that Yan Xiu knew exactly what he meant.


Of course, that was the truth as well.


Yan Xiu closed his eyes and sat down.


Fang Zhengzhi turned to look at the two middle-aged men once again. To be precise, he turned on the middle-aged men who had blood on his sword.


"Die!" Fang Zhengzhi did not think too much.


After all...


This was just a dream.


Then, he leapt into action. He did not think too much as too what technique he wanted to use. He only had one technique in his heart, the one he just witnessed.


The technique that had split the Blood Shadow City into two. The one that still left its mark till this day.


The purple dragon shot to the sky.


It charged towards the heavens and morphed into a twisting ray of purple light.


Fang Zhengzhi thought that this was definitely a dream. He never expected that he would be able to use this technique. This technique's power was indescribable.


The torrential rain started at that moment.


Raindrops splattered on his face, causing a cooling effect. However, the purple showed no signs of dissipating. In fact, it intensified.


The world was completely purple. Even the rain was purple.


Was this a dream?


A purple dream?


...


"Clang!" The middle-aged man's sword dropped to the ground. By this time, it was no longer a sword. It was a hilt with no blade.


As a Rebirth State cultivator...


His sword would not be destroyed even if it had been cracked. He would be able to use Dao to keep the blade intact.


But the fact was that his sword had broke, smashed to smithereens.


There was only one possible explanation. His Rebirth State Dao was insufficient to protect his sword.


The middle-aged man's gaze was lost as he looked on exasperatedly. He did not know what just happened, but he knew that the facts could not be changed.


"Young Master!" The middle-aged man turned to look at Yun Qingwu, who was still on top the cliff.


Yun Qingwu's white dress was initially dancing in the torrential rain. However, as her dress collected more and more raindrops, it became too heavy for the wind to lift.


Her veil was drenched and stuck to her face. Even though one still couldn't see her face, her exquisite features were obvious.


The middle-aged man wanted to say something to Yun Qingwu.


However, he realized that Yun Qingwu was not looking at him. Instead, she was looking at the youth in front of him.


He suddenly understood what was happening. He could tell what Yun Qingwu was thinking. This feeling originated from the expression beneath the veil.


He saw that Yun Qingwu was smiling.


That's right...


Smiling.


The middle-aged man did not know why she was so joyous, but he had a feeling that her joy had something to do with this youth.


Was it because the youth wasn't dead?


Or was it because...


Was the youth very powerful?


The middle-aged man no longer looked at Yun Qingwu. He turned to look at Fang Zhengzhi. He felt like he had to do something.


"Can you tell me the name of the technique you just used?" The middle-aged man stared at Fang Zhengzhi's eyes, which were completely stained purple.


"Name?" Fang Zhengzhi had no idea why the people in his dreams would ask such strange questions. Since they were characters in his dream, they should know what he did.


He didn't feel like responding.


However, when he heard the middle-aged man's question, the technique flashed in his mind and he felt an urge to say its name.


Maybe...


It was a memory.


Maybe this memory wanted to let him know that it existed.


Regardless of the reason, Fang Zhengzhi answered the question in a simple and straightforward manner.


"This technique is known as... The Returning Dragon!"
